How To Build A Cheap Chicken Coop-4 Critical Considerations

If you want to build a cheap chicken coop, as many people are doing nowadays for obvious financial and environmental reasons, you will need to consider 4 major factors. The benefits of building your own chicken coop are many and today I will look at 4 factors that you will need to consider.

These factors include the protection of the birds, the size of the coop, the protection that it affords the birds and it’s appearance. This article will look more closely at these factors and allow you to build the best chicken coop for you.

Factor 1–Size
The size of your coop will be determined by the number of birds that you want. It is better to err on the larger size as the birds will need adequate space to ensure their wellbeing and productivity.

Factor 2-Portable or Fixed
You may be satisfied with a portable coop which will allow you to move it around for cleaning purposes and if you think that the birds will also be family pets.

Factor 3-Protection
The sturdiness of your coop and its ability to withstand predators is a factor to consider seriously and the erection of a protective fence around the coop will be necessary in some locations.

Factor 4-Appearance
The appearance of your coop will sometimes be a major factor depending on your location. Many people in rural areas will not be too particular about this but for town or city dwellers you will need to consider this and it will impact on your costs.

To build a cheap chicken coop there are other factors which you will need to consider including sourcing the correct materials and a good set of plans and instructions.
